Abstract:
The ZSM-5 zeolites and ZSM-5-zeolite containing catalysts coked and annealed from the catalyst coke to a various extent were investigated with IRS and HREM methods. The mechanisms of carbonising and of coke deposition and burning-out were examined. It was established that coke deposits mainly on the outer surface of the polycrystals, outside the coherent area. The coke formation is catalysed by strong Lewis acid sites with vco=2225–2228 sm−1. The area inside the zeolite channels is free from coke deposits up to 7–9 wt.%. The mechanisms of carbonising and of coke burning-out are examined.
